I have a QMX 80-20 that KC3SHC put together for me.? I downloaded and unzipped the program, and loaded it into the rig.? I did have to use the jumper pin 7-8 method.
Testing, all I get is a row of dark boxes across the display.? Checked?for opens, shorts, etc.
Will not boot.? Any ideas?

Remembering my assembly of the QMX that contrast pot was VERY touchy. I went through that panic of black boxes to blank green screen to find a very narrow setting near the right-hand stop that produced a readable screen.

Sounds like my issue.? If the switching mode power supplies fail, the display looks like that.

If you have puTTY on your PC, try to connect on USB.? Mine was on COM6, but yours may not be.



Putty is also available on linux.? There is a writeup on using it in the operation manual.

If you connect and get the diagnostic screen (and only the diagnostic screen) you probably need to fix your SMPS.
